This was apparent on Tuesday when a drunk man decided to take a fully naked stroll through the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port.

“A man who was caught on camera going on a naked, drunken walk through a terminal at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port has been arrested,” NBC Miami reported. “The incident happened around 2 p.m. Monday when 36-year-old Martin Evtimov parked his vehicle on the sidewalk outside Terminal One, Broward Sheriff’s Office officials said,” NBC Miami’s report continued. “Evtimov, who was naked, walked into the terminal and breached a secure Transportation Security Administration checkpoint.”

A social media user posted a video of the man walking naked through the airport on X.

“A naked man was caught on camera earlier today at Ft. Lauderdale Airport as he tried to make his way past the TSA!” the account ONLY in DADE wrote.

The footage has since been removed from X.

When approached by deputies and TSA officers, Evtimov resisted arrest before being subdued and taken into custody by law enforcement.

Evtimov was booked into jail and charged with battery on a law enforcement officer, resisting arrest with violence, disorderly conduct, disorderly intoxication, and indecent exposure.

On Tuesday, Evtimov appeared in court where a judge granted him a $3,500 bond and ordered him to undergo mental health screening, avoid alcohol, and stay away from the airport.

“I do find probable cause on all counts,” the judge said. “I’m giving no return to the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port.”

Evtimov attempted to address the court during his hearing; however, the judge denied his request and refused to let him talk.

“No, sir,” the judge said. “I’m not going to allow you to make any statements on the record right now.”
